Using a medicine ball you will perform the med ball crunch, med ball mou...4. Medicine Ball Balance. Stand on one leg and hold the ball overhead with both hands for 30 seconds. Then, hold the ball in one hand, extend your arm out to the side and balance on the corresponding foot for an additional 30 seconds. Repeat the same routine while holding the ball in the opposite hand and balancing on the opposite leg.

In fact, you can even complete Dynamax med ball exercises on the beach!Beginner medicine ball exercises. → Medicine ball squat. This targets the legs and core. Stand with legs hip-width apart and toes facing forwards. Hold a medicine ball by the middle of your chest, pressing your hands into either side of the ball.
